  1/* SPDX-License-Identifier: GPL-2.0 */
  2/*
  3  File: linux/ext2_xattr.h
  4
  5  On-disk format of extended attributes for the ext2 filesystem.
  6
  7  (C) 2001 Andreas Gruenbacher, <a.gruenbacher@computer.org>
  8*/
  9
 10#include <linux/init.h>
 11#include <linux/xattr.h>
 12
 13/* Magic value in attribute blocks */
 14#define EXT2_XATTR_MAGIC		0xEA020000
 15
 16/* Maximum number of references to one attribute block */
 17#define EXT2_XATTR_REFCOUNT_MAX		1024
 18
 19/* Name indexes */
 20#define EXT2_XATTR_INDEX_USER			1
 21#define EXT2_XATTR_INDEX_POSIX_ACL_ACCESS	2
 22#define EXT2_XATTR_INDEX_POSIX_ACL_DEFAULT	3
 23#define EXT2_XATTR_INDEX_TRUSTED		4
 24#define	EXT2_XATTR_INDEX_LUSTRE			5
 25#define EXT2_XATTR_INDEX_SECURITY	        6
 26
 27struct ext2_xattr_header {
 28	__le32	h_magic;	/* magic number for identification */
 29	__le32	h_refcount;	/* reference count */
 30	__le32	h_blocks;	/* number of disk blocks used */
 31	__le32	h_hash;		/* hash value of all attributes */
 32	__u32	h_reserved[4];	/* zero right now */
 33};
 34
 35struct ext2_xattr_entry {
 36	__u8	e_name_len;	/* length of name */
 37	__u8	e_name_index;	/* attribute name index */
 38	__le16	e_value_offs;	/* offset in disk block of value */
 39	__le32	e_value_block;	/* disk block attribute is stored on (n/i) */
 40	__le32	e_value_size;	/* size of attribute value */
 41	__le32	e_hash;		/* hash value of name and value */
 42	char	e_name[];	/* attribute name */
 43};
 44
 45#define EXT2_XATTR_PAD_BITS		2
 46#define EXT2_XATTR_PAD		(1<<EXT2_XATTR_PAD_BITS)
 47#define EXT2_XATTR_ROUND		(EXT2_XATTR_PAD-1)
 48#define EXT2_XATTR_LEN(name_len) \
 49	(((name_len) + EXT2_XATTR_ROUND + \
 50	sizeof(struct ext2_xattr_entry)) & ~EXT2_XATTR_ROUND)
 51#define EXT2_XATTR_NEXT(entry) \
 52	( (struct ext2_xattr_entry *)( \
 53	  (char *)(entry) + EXT2_XATTR_LEN((entry)->e_name_len)) )
 54#define EXT2_XATTR_SIZE(size) \
 55	(((size) + EXT2_XATTR_ROUND) & ~EXT2_XATTR_ROUND)
 56
 57struct mb_cache;
 58
 59# ifdef CONFIG_EXT2_FS_XATTR
 60
 61extern const struct xattr_handler ext2_xattr_user_handler;
 62extern const struct xattr_handler ext2_xattr_trusted_handler;
 63extern const struct xattr_handler ext2_xattr_security_handler;
 64
 65extern ssize_t ext2_listxattr(struct dentry *, char *, size_t);
 66
 67extern int ext2_xattr_get(struct inode *, int, const char *, void *, size_t);
 68extern int ext2_xattr_set(struct inode *, int, const char *, const void *, size_t, int);
 69
 70extern void ext2_xattr_delete_inode(struct inode *);
 
 71
 72extern struct mb_cache *ext2_xattr_create_cache(void);
 73extern void ext2_xattr_destroy_cache(struct mb_cache *cache);
 74
 75extern const struct xattr_handler * const ext2_xattr_handlers[];
 76
 77# else  /* CONFIG_EXT2_FS_XATTR */
 78
 79static inline int
 80ext2_xattr_get(struct inode *inode, int name_index,
 81	       const char *name, void *buffer, size_t size)
 82{
 83	return -EOPNOTSUPP;
 84}
 85
 86static inline int
 87ext2_xattr_set(struct inode *inode, int name_index, const char *name,
 88	       const void *value, size_t size, int flags)
 89{
 90	return -EOPNOTSUPP;
 91}
 92
 93static inline void
 94ext2_xattr_delete_inode(struct inode *inode)
 95{
 96}
 97
 98static inline void ext2_xattr_destroy_cache(struct mb_cache *cache)
 
 
 
 
 
 
 
 
 
 
 
 
 99{
100}
101
102#define ext2_xattr_handlers NULL
103#define ext2_listxattr NULL
104
105# endif  /* CONFIG_EXT2_FS_XATTR */
106
107#ifdef CONFIG_EXT2_FS_SECURITY
108extern int ext2_init_security(struct inode *inode, struct inode *dir,
109			      const struct qstr *qstr);
110#else
111static inline int ext2_init_security(struct inode *inode, struct inode *dir,
112				     const struct qstr *qstr)
113{
114	return 0;
115}
116#endif
